Research Topics
Participants will engage in one of the following tentative research projects, aligned with their academic background and/or interests:
1. Phytoremediation of Arsenic-Contaminated Soils
Supervisor: Prof. Lena Ma, Chair Professor of Environmental Biogeochemistry of Trace Metals
Focus: Using arsenic-hyperaccumulator plants like Pteris vittata to clean arsenic-contaminated soils, with a focus on the molecular and physiological mechanisms underlying its efficient arsenic accumulation to improve environmental remediation and food safety.
2. Oral Bioavailability of Metal Contaminants in the environment
Supervisor: Prof. Lena Ma, Chair Professor of Environmental Biogeochemistry of Trace Metals
Focus: Exploring the technology and mechanisms in reducing the bioavailability of metal contaminants in soil, dust, and food using a mouse model, with applications in reducing metal exposure risks to humans.
3. Mechanisms of Nitrogen Cycling in Paddy/Upland Crop Rotations
Supervisor: Prof. Yongchao Liang, Principal Investigator
Focus: Investigating nitrogen cycling networks, greenhouse gas emissions, and microbial mechanisms in paddy/upland crop rotations to enhance fertilizer efficiency and soil sustainability.
4. Silicon-Alleviated Chromium Toxicity in Rice
Supervisor: Prof. Yongchao Liang, Principal Investigator
Focus: Examining how silicon alleviates chromium toxicity in rice, focusing on molecular and physiological mechanisms for improving crop resilience and food safety.
5. Investigating Environmental Exposures and Health
Supervisor: Prof. Chao Jiang, Principal Investigator
Focus: Analyzing the interplay between environmental exposures and human health, with research on microbial communities, metabolite analysis, and next-generation sequencing.
6. Investigating the role of bacteria in desert restoration
Supervisor: Prof. Chao Jiang, Principal Investigator
Focus: Using molecular and bioinformatic analyses, we aim to find more microbes that can facilitate the weathering process of sand particles via different molecular pathways.
